Output 01ef5a1cecf4289576b3a26ff0d717d17f36df77f16810149695625a84c15030:1

value
131961521
script pubkey
OP_0 OP_PUSHBYTES_20 81812703d17198ce3a82ca0120260e92534bd8aa
address
tb1qsxqjwq73wxvvuw5zegqjqfswjff5hk929uh4ka
transaction
01ef5a1cecf4289576b3a26ff0d717d17f36df77f16810149695625a84c15030
confirmations
26643
spent
true